For best results when printing this announcement, please click on the linkbelow:http://pdf.reuters.com/pdfnews/pdfnews.asp?i=43059c3bf0e37541&u=urn:newsml:reuters.com:20120709:nPnUKM527 DUBAI, July 9, 2012 /PRNewswire/ --Etihad Etisalat (Mobily), the leading telecommunications company in SaudiArabia, and Pacific Controls, the leading global provider of ICT-enabled managedservices and converged engineering solutions for buildings and infrastructureprojects, have announced the signing of a Partnership Agreement to jointly offermachine-to-machine (M2M) Energy Management solutions for vertical industrysectors in the Kingdom of Saudi Arabia. It will enable new modes of service delivery and customer value creation.However, to leverage the full potential of this opportunity, customers will neednew tools and technologies as well as complete end-to-end solutions support.Pacific Controls is at the forefront of next generation service deliveryinnovation and its partnership with Mobily now offers customers in Saudi Arabia access to Entergy Management Services value propositions.As per the agreement, Mobily and Pacific Controls will join forces to cater tothe business needs of sectors such as Energy and Utilities, Government,Healthcare, Financial, Retail etc. With Mobily's telecommunicationinfrastructure and broadband network capabilities and Pacific Controls'expertise in the fields of energy management, remote monitoring and controlthrough M2M applications, customers will be able to cut their operational costsby availing services of Energy Analysis, Carbon Footprint Reduction, Measurement& Verification, Continuous Commissioning and Fault Detection and Diagnostics.Dr. Marwan al Ahmadi, Chief Business Officer, Mobily, said "As a leading ICTprovider, Mobily is at the forefront of innovation. We are continuouslyoffering innovative technology solutions to add value to customers' businessesto enable them to achieve their goals."In addition to adding value to customers' businesses and introducing initiativesto provide optimum benefits to end-users, the five year agreement willincorporate a state of the art Command and Control Centre based in Riyadh,utilizing the latest M2M technology platform, to position Mobily and the Kingdomas one of the leading proponents in Energy Management Services.About Pacific ControlsPacific Controls (PCS) provides ICT enabled managed services and convergedengineering solutions for buildings and infrastructure projects globally.
